In today’s digital age, where cyber threats are becoming more prevalent and sophisticated, ensuring the resilience of your organization’s systems and networks is imperative. cyber resilience testing, also known as cybersecurity resilience testing, is a crucial practice that helps organizations identify and address vulnerabilities in their IT infrastructure before they can be exploited by malicious actors.
cyber resilience testing involves conducting a series of tests and assessments to evaluate the overall security posture of an organization’s systems and networks. These tests are designed to simulate real-world cyber attacks and identify potential weaknesses that could be exploited by cybercriminals. By proactively identifying and addressing vulnerabilities, organizations can strengthen their defenses and mitigate the risk of a successful cyber attack.

There are several key components of cyber resilience testing that organizations should consider when developing their testing strategy. Firstly, organizations should conduct regular vulnerability assessments to identify potential entry points for attackers. Vulnerability assessments involve scanning systems and networks for known weaknesses and misconfigurations that could be exploited by cybercriminals. By addressing these vulnerabilities proactively, organizations can reduce the risk of a successful cyber attack.
Secondly, organizations should conduct penetration testing to evaluate the effectiveness of their security controls in a simulated cyber attack scenario. Penetration testing, also known as ethical hacking, involves attempting to breach systems and networks using the same techniques and tools that real attackers would use. By uncovering weaknesses in their defenses through penetration testing, organizations can strengthen their security posture and improve their resilience to cyber threats.
Thirdly, organizations should consider conducting incident response testing to ensure that they are prepared to respond effectively to a cyber attack. Incident response testing involves simulating a cyber attack and evaluating the organization’s ability to detect, contain, and eradicate the threat. By testing their incident response procedures in a controlled environment, organizations can identify gaps in their response capabilities and make improvements to their incident response plan.
